Navigating Conflict with Grace

Conflict has a way of turning one moment, one mistake, or one disagreement into a verdict about another person. In the final week of NAVIGATE: Family Month, we look at James 2:12–13 and the powerful declaration that “mercy triumphs over judgment.” We’ll discover how judgment can move from disagreement to contempt, why we tend to give ourselves context while giving everyone else a conclusion, and how mercy interrupts that cycle. Mercy doesn’t ignore what happened or call wrong right. Instead, it refuses to reduce someone to their worst moment and chooses what happens next. Because healthy families don’t keep score, they extend mercy.
